Subject: Bounce processor cut-over complete

Team, the migration of the Harrowfield bounce processor from the legacy poller to the webhook-driven pipeline finished last night. All bounce classifications now flow through the new parser; the old queue is drained and frozen for thirty days in case we need replays. Suppression-list updates are synchronous again, so delays reported last quarter should disappear. For future reference, the configuration the new service went live with is recorded below.

deployment values, tafof-taduf:
pelius:
  pin: 6508
  tenant: praiel
  seal: seal_4e33a2f4
  metrics_host: metrics.pelius.plorvagrid.corp
  standby_team: druix
  escalation: juldor-norius
  nonce: 5db598

Action item from the Quillbark API postmortem: our public REST pagination fell over when Fernwheel's bulk importer requested page sizes way beyond anything we'd tested. We never enforced a ceiling, so one client could drag the whole read path down. Fix is simple — clamp page size, add a sane default, and cap total offset depth. Reviewer, please sanity-check the numbers against last month's traffic, not just the happy path. Proposed constants below.

tuning constants:
WEIGHTS = {
    "kasion": 449,
    "julax": 314,
    "novdor": 823,
    "ralmir": 390,
    "novael": 220,
}

Re: Transport of the Obsidian-9 hardware security module. The unit ships Thursday from our Calderwyn facility to the Norrow Vale data centre in a tamper-evident case. Assign a vetted driver; route must avoid overnight stops, and the case stays in the driver's sight at all times. Receiving staff will inspect seals before acceptance and will refuse any case showing damage. Per the security desk, the receiving officer will only take custody after the driver states the following phrase:

courier memo of yahif-faweg: the quenael tamius courier leaves the prawyn jorix kaswyn istox silmir brieth zormir fenvan ledger at gate 3145 under passcode 231062